What you'll learn
Integration as the reverse of differentiation for polynomials, always with '+C' on indefinite integrals, definite integrals, area under a curve, and simple kinematics.
- Integration reverses the power rule: raise the power by one, then divide by the NEW power
- An indefinite integral must ALWAYS end in '+C'; forgetting it is a real, common error
- A constant on its own integrates to (constant) \(\times\, x\), plus C
- A definite integral has limits and gives a NUMBER, with no '+C'
- The area under a curve, above the x-axis, between two x-values is a definite integral
- Kinematics: displacement, velocity, and acceleration are linked by differentiation and integration in opposite directions
